The Falcon Girl Sout is a variant of the Falcon Miniature made by Utility Manufacturing Company in Chicago. The viewfinder camera makes 16 1 5/8"×1 1/4" exposures (ca. 3×4cm) on a standard type 127 film roll. Its simple ever-ready shutter operates in the modes Time or Instant. It has a 50mm Minivar lens.
